* @brief Initializes a collective communication group in an actor instance.
*
* This function is used to initialize a collective communication group in the current actor instance.
* Typically in distributed training or parallel computing scenarios, each process needs to call this function to join a
* collective communication group.
*
* @param groupSpec Configuration specification for the collective communication group, including worldSize, groupName,
* backend, and timeout.
* @param rank Rank of the current process in the group, should be in the range [0, worldSize-1].
* @param prefix Storage prefix for key-value storage used by backend communication. Default is an empty string.
* @note Must be called after YR::Init(). The same groupName cannot be initialized repeatedly, otherwise an exception
* will be thrown. groupName must match the regex: ^[a-zA-Z0-9\-_!#%\^\*\(\)\+\=\:;]*$
* Mixing CreateCollectiveGroup (in driver) and InitCollectiveGroup (in actor) for the same group is not
* supported. All members of a group must use either CreateCollectiveGroup or InitCollectiveGroup exclusively. Dynamic
* addition or removal of group members is not supported. Once a group is created, the member count is fixed.
* @throws Exception Thrown if called before initialization, if groupName is invalid, or if the collective group already
* exists.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p init collective group
*/
void InitCollectiveGroup(const CollectiveGroupSpec &groupSpec, int rank, const std::string &prefix = "");
* @brief Creates a collective communication group in the driver using actor instance IDs.
*
* This function is used to create a collective communication group in the driver process, specifying the actor
* instances participating in collective communication and their corresponding ranks. Typically in distributed training
* scenarios, the driver process calls this function to create the group, and then each actor instance joins the group
* through InitCollectiveGroup.
*
* @param groupSpec Configuration specification for the collective communication group.
* @param instanceIDs List of actor instance IDs, size must equal worldSize.
* @param ranks List of ranks corresponding to each instance, size must equal worldSize, and rank values should be in
* the range [0, worldSize-1].
* @note The size of instanceIDs must equal worldSize. The size of ranks must equal worldSize.
* If groupName already exists, an exception will be thrown. You need to call DestroyCollectiveGroup first to
* destroy the existing group.
* Mixing CreateCollectiveGroup (in driver) and InitCollectiveGroup (in actor) for the same group is not
* supported. All members of a group must use either CreateCollectiveGroup or InitCollectiveGroup exclusively. Dynamic
* addition or removal of group members is not supported. Once a group is created, the member count is fixed.
* @throws Exception Thrown if instanceIDs, ranks, and worldSize don't match, if groupName already exists, or if
* groupName is invalid.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p create collective group
*/
void CreateCollectiveGroup(const CollectiveGroupSpec &groupSpec, const std::vector<std::string> &instanceIDs,
const std::vector<int> &ranks);
* @brief Destroys the specified collective communication group.
*
* This function is used to destroy a created collective communication group and release related resources.
*
* @param groupName Name of the group to destroy.
* @note If the group doesn't exist, this function won't throw an exception and will handle it silently.
*/
void DestroyCollectiveGroup(const std::string &groupName);
* @brief Performs a reduction operation across all processes and broadcasts the result to all processes.
*
* This function performs a reduction operation (such as sum, max, etc.) across all processes and writes the result back
* to all processes' recvbuf. All processes' recvbuf will eventually contain the same result.
*
* @param sendbuf Send buffer containing local input data. All processes' sendbuf should have the same size.
* @param recvbuf Receive buffer for storing the reduction result. Size should be the same as sendbuf.
* @param count Number of data elements.
* @param dtype Data type (DataType::INT, DataType::FLOAT, DataType::DOUBLE, DataType::LONG).
* @param op Reduction operator (ReduceOp::SUM, ReduceOp::PRODUCT, ReduceOp::MIN, ReduceOp::MAX).
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note sendbuf and recvbuf can point to the same memory (in-place operation). All processes must call this function
* with consistent parameters. Must be called after the group is created and initialized.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p allreduce example
*/
void AllReduce(const void *sendbuf, void *recvbuf, int count, DataType dtype, const ReduceOp &op,
const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
* @brief Performs a reduction operation across all processes and sends the result to the specified destination process.
*
* This function performs a reduction operation across all processes, but only the dstRank process's recvbuf will
* contain the reduction result. The recvbuf content of other processes is undefined.
*
* @param sendbuf Send buffer containing local input data.
* @param recvbuf Receive buffer, only used in the dstRank process, for storing the reduction result. Other processes'
* recvbuf content is undefined.
* @param count Number of data elements.
* @param dtype Data type.
* @param op Reduction operator.
* @param dstRank Rank of the destination process where the reduction result will be sent.
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note The recvbuf output data of non-root ranks (non-dstRank) is unreliable and should not be used. Only the dstRank
* process's recvbuf contains valid reduction results.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p reduce example
*/
void Reduce(const void *sendbuf, void *recvbuf, int count, DataType dtype, const ReduceOp &op, int dstRank,
const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
* @brief Gathers data from all processes and broadcasts the result to all processes.
*
* This function gathers data from all processes and writes the gathered data back to all processes' recvbuf in rank
* order. The size of recvbuf should be count * worldSize.
*
* @param sendbuf Send buffer containing local data to send.
* @param recvbuf Receive buffer for storing data gathered from all processes. Size should be count * worldSize.
* @param count Number of data elements sent by each process.
* @param dtype Data type.
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note The size of recvbuf must be at least count * worldSize. Gathered data is arranged in rank order in recvbuf.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p allgather example
*/
void AllGather(const void *sendbuf, void *recvbuf, int count, DataType dtype,
const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
* @brief Synchronization barrier that blocks until all processes in the group reach this point.
*
* This function is used to synchronize all processes, ensuring that all processes reach the Barrier call point before
* executing subsequent code.
*
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note All processes must call this function, otherwise it will cause a deadlock. This function blocks until all
* processes reach the Barrier call point.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p barrier example
*/
void Barrier(const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
* @brief Scatters data from the source process to all processes.
*
* This function scatters data from the srcRank process's sendbuf vector to all processes.
* The sendbuf vector of the srcRank process should contain worldSize buffers, each buffer corresponding to a target
* rank.
*
* @param sendbuf Send buffer vector, only used in the srcRank process. Size should be worldSize, each element points to
* data to be sent to the corresponding rank.
* @param recvbuf Receive buffer for storing data received from srcRank.
* @param count Number of data elements received by each process.
* @param dtype Data type.
* @param srcRank Rank of the source process.
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note The sendbuf vector is only used in the srcRank process, other processes can pass an empty vector. The size of
* the sendbuf vector must equal worldSize.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p scatter example
*/
void Scatter(const std::vector<void *> sendbuf, void *recvbuf, int count, DataType dtype, int srcRank,
const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
* @brief Broadcasts data from the source process to all processes.
*
* This function broadcasts data from the srcRank process to all processes in the group.
* All processes' recvbuf will eventually contain the same data (from srcRank's sendbuf).
*
* @param sendbuf Send buffer, only used in the srcRank process, containing data to broadcast.
* @param recvbuf Receive buffer for storing the broadcast data. All processes' recvbuf will eventually contain the same
* data.
* @param count Number of data elements.
* @param dtype Data type.
* @param srcRank Rank of the source process.
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note sendbuf and recvbuf can point to the same memory (in-place operation). All processes must call this function
* with consistent parameters.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p broadcast example
*/
void Broadcast(const void *sendbuf, void *recvbuf, int count, DataType dtype, int srcRank,
const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
* @brief Receives data from the specified process.
*
* This function is used for point-to-point communication, receiving data from the specified source process.
* Must be paired with the Send function, matched through the tag parameter.
*
* @param recvbuf Receive buffer for storing received data.
* @param count Number of data elements to receive.
* @param dtype Data type.
* @param srcRank Rank of the source process.
* @param tag Message tag for matching the corresponding Send operation, default is 0.
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note Recv and Send must be paired, and tags must match. Recv operation blocks until the corresponding Send operation
* is called. count and dtype must match the corresponding Send operation.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p send recv example
*/
void Recv(void *recvbuf, int count, DataType dtype, int srcRank, int tag = 0,
const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
* @brief Sends data to the specified process.
*
* This function is used for point-to-point communication, sending data to the specified destination process.
* Must be paired with the Recv function, matched through the tag parameter.
*
* @param sendbuf Send buffer containing data to send.
* @param count Number of data elements to send.
* @param dtype Data type.
* @param dstRank Rank of the destination process.
* @param tag Message tag for matching the corresponding Recv operation, default is 0.
* @param groupName Name of the group, default is "default".
* @note Send and Recv must be paired, and tags must match. Send operation blocks until the corresponding Recv operation
* is called.
* @throws Exception Thrown if the group doesn't exist or hasn't been created yet.
*
* @snippet{trimleft} collective_example.cpp send recv example
*/
void Send(const void *sendbuf, int count, DataType dtype, int dstRank, int tag = 0,
const std::string &groupName = DEFAULT_GROUP_NAME);
